5 digestive tips to boost mental and physical well-being:

1. Initiate with Lemon Water: Before diving into your meal, start by hydrating with lemon water about 30 minutes prior. This not only revs up the production of hydrochloric acid, vital for breaking down food, but also sets a positive, refreshing tone for your meal.

2. Embrace the Ritual of Chewing: Slow and steady wins the race, especially when it comes to digestion. Chewing your food meticulously has dual benefits: aiding physical digestion and offering a moment of mindfulness, which can help ground and calm the mind.

3. Mindful Eating for Body and Mind: Beyond aiding digestion, engaging in mindful eating can serve as a form of meditation. As you immerse your senses in the meal, you nurture both gratitude and presence. This can be a wonderful reprieve from the day’s stresses, allowing for mental relaxation and improved digestion.

4. Master the 80/20 Rule: Overeating can cause not just physical discomfort but can cloud the mind and lead to feelings of lethargy. By aiming to be 80% full, you maintain a physical and mental balance, ensuring that you’re nourished but not overwhelmed.

5. Walk to Digest and Reflect: Post-meal, opt for a gentle stroll. Physically, this aids digestion, while mentally, it offers a reflective space to process thoughts, de-stress, and cultivate gratitude.
